Berlin, Nevada lingers in the desert like a half remembered verse from the mining age. Founded in 1897, the town rose quickly on the promise of the Berlin Mine, its 30 stamp mill pounding out a metallic heartbeat that echoed across the Shoshone Range. For a few bright years, especially around 1900–1905, the settlement felt charged with purpose—company houses aligned neatly against the wind, a modest main street tracing the ambitions of men who believed the hills would reward their labor. But the ore never lived up to its early whispers, and by 1907, as financial panic rippled across the nation, Berlin’s confidence began to fray. The mill fell silent; families drifted away; by 1911, the town had emptied into the vastness around it. What remains now are weather silvered boards and doorframes leaning into time, offering a quiet reminder that even the most determined human endeavors can dissolve into stillness, leaving behind only the poetry of what once hoped to endure.
